The ‘hospice movement’ is an umbrella term for the growth of end of life and palliative care services in the UK over the past 50 years or so – both in the voluntary and statutory sectors. 1014851, and in Scotland No. Though hospice care may be growing in popularity within and outside of the UK, there is still a significant amount of people who are not aware of a lot of information related to the provision of this service. The first hospice to open in the United Kingdom was the Trinity Hospice in Clapham south London in 1891, on the initiative of the Hoare banking family.
